ASP MDB 制作网站登录
(图片来源网络,侵删)
1. 创建数据库和表
在Microsoft Access中创建一个新的数据库,例如命名为"website.mdb",然后在该数据库中创建一个名为"users"的表,包含以下字段:
字段名 | 数据类型 | 描述 |
id | 自动编号 | 用户ID |
username | 文本 | 用户名 |
password | 文本 | 密码 |
2. 连接数据库
在ASP页面中,使用以下代码连接到数据库:
<% Dim conn Set conn = Server.CreateObject("ADODB.Connection") conn.Provider = "Microsoft.Jet.OLEDB.4.0" conn.ConnectionString = "Data Source=" & Server.MapPath("website.mdb") conn.Open %>
3. 登录表单
创建一个HTML表单,用于收集用户名和密码:
<form action="login.asp" method="post"> <label for="username">用户名:</label> <input type="text" name="username" id="username" required> <br> <label for="password">密码:</label> <input type="password" name="password" id="password" required> <br> <input type="submit" value="登录"> </form>
4. 验证登录信息
在"login.asp"页面中,编写ASP代码来验证用户输入的用户名和密码:
<% Dim username, password, sql, rs username = Request.Form("username") password = Request.Form("password") sql = "SELECT * FROM users WHERE username='" & username & "' AND password='" & password & "'" Set rs = conn.Execute(sql) If Not rs.EOF Then Response.Write("登录成功!") Else Response.Write("用户名或密码错误,请重试。") End If %>
5. 关闭数据库连接
在完成所有操作后,关闭数据库连接:
<% rs.Close Set rs = Nothing conn.Close Set conn = Nothing %>
原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/684089.html
本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。
发表回复